American Idol Picks....

Feb 24, 2007 01:31

Here's who I think the Top 12 ( Read more... )

Leave a comment

Comments 2

smurfmonkeys February 24 2007, 14:04:21 UTC
I wish I could keep track with what's going on with American Idol. No TV here, bah!

Reply

slayerboi February 24 2007, 16:45:50 UTC
i'd go nuts without a TV.

Reply


Leave a comment

Up